Warning Signs You Need Under Sink Water Extraction
Water damage under your sink can be a sign of a larger issue, and it’s essential to catch it early to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ty or mildewy smell coming from under your sink, it’s a sign that water is accumulating in the area. This can lead to mold and mildew growth, which can be hazardous to your health.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ring is a sign that water has seeped into the subfloor and is causing damage. If left unchecked, this can lead to costly repairs and even structural damage to your home.
Discoloration or Stains
Discoloration or stains on your walls, ceiling, or flooring can be a sign of water damage. If left unchecked, these stains can spread and become more difficult to clean.
Unusual Noises
Unusual noises coming from under your sink, such as gurgling or dripping sounds, can be a sign that water is accumulating in the area. This can lead to further damage and costly repairs if left unchecked.
Visible Water Damage

Under Sink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under sink | Yes | No | You can likely fix the leak yourself with some basic plumbing tools. |
| Major flood under sink | No | Yes | A major flood needs specialized equipment and expertise to extract water and dry the area. |
| Water damage to surrounding areas | No | Yes | Water damage to surrounding areas need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ry and dehumidify the affected area. |
| Musty odors or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th can be hazardous to your health, and need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ove. |

Common Questions About Under Sink Water Extraction
Q: What causes water damage under my sink?
A: Water damage under your sink can be caused by a burst pipe, leaky faucet, or other plumbing issue. It’s essential to address the problem qu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Q: How long does the Under Sink Water Extraction process take?
A: The Under Sink Water Extraction process typically takes 3-5 days to complete,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Q: Is Under Sink Water Extraction covered by insurance?
A: Yes, Under Sink Water Extraction services are often covered by insurance. But, it’s essential to check with your insurance provider to confirm coverage and to file a claim.
Q: Can I prevent water damage under my sink?
A: Yes, you can prevent water damage under your sink by regularly inspecting your plumbing and addressing any issues quickly. You can also install a water shut-off valve and consider using a water sensor to detect leaks.
